Show the underline for keyboard shortcutTag(s): Common problems

That's standard Windows (XP) behavior.

The underlines won't appear until you press the ALT key.

To disable it and have the underline always visible, right-click the Desktop, choose Properties, and click the Appearance tab. Click the Effects button and remove the check mark from the line Hide Underlined Letters for Keyboard Navigation Until I Press The Alt Key.
